BACKGROUND Since 1991, the City of Santa Clarita (City) has assumed responsibility from the County of Los Angeles Department of Public Works (County) for public transportation services in the Santa Clarita Valley (Valley). In return, the County reimburses the City for transportation services operated in the Valley's unincorporated areas. Based on the current level of public transportation service provided, the County reimburses the City as follows: • 14.78 percent of local bus service costs • 22.97 percent of commuter express bus service costs • 11.95 percent of paratransit (Dial -a -Ride) service costs • Bus procurements shared by the County using above allocations • 15 percent administrative overhead fee These percentages have remained consistent over the years, and are being proposed in the next agreement that will cover Fiscal Year 2026-27 to Fiscal Year 2028-29. City staff works closely with the County to ensure that the level of public transportation services meets the needs of County residents, and that the City is properly compensated for the services provided in the unincorporated areas of the Valley. Page 1 Packet Pg. 99 ALTERNATIVE ACTION Other action as determined by the City Council. FISCAL IMPACT The Los Angeles County maximum contribution is $3,741,000 for Fiscal Year 2026-27. The resources required to implement the recommended action are contained within the City of Santa Clarita's adopted FY 2026-27 budget. Budget for FY 2027-28 is contingent upon appropriations of funds by the City Council during the annual budget process. Page 2 Packet Pg. 100
